The Opportunity

We are looking for a detail-oriented and dynamic Clinician Liaison to support the day-to-day activities of managing a specific clinical service line and assigned to a group of physicians and Advanced Practice Providers (APPs), together known as ‘clinicians.’ The Clinician Liaison is key to the success of the Neurology service line’s operational performance and clinical culture, ensuring proactively that clinicians have what they need to succeed and thrive in their clinical work.

What

You’ll Do
  • Act as the key agent, for neurologists and Advanced Practice Providers (APPs) with administration:
    • Build and sustain trust-based relationships with clinicians, checking in frequently, proactively solving problems and mustering resources, advocating for support
    • Respond timely to clinician needs for administrative support (e.g., Payroll, HR, Legal, Accounting, IT, Revenue Cycle, Clinical Support)
    • Expedite administration for hiring, onboarding, employment status changes, off-boarding
    • Anticipate, push, communicate, and help clinicians fully prepare for their first shifts
    • Arrange and support clinician training, including with hospital EMR systems
    • Liaise between clinicians, company administration, and clients as needed
    • Support clinicians in completion of credentialing, licensing, privileging, EMR access and training
    • Maintain critical information for clinicians’ clinical effectiveness on-shift: privileging profiles, EMR and EEG system access information, client-specific workflows
    • Notify clinicians timely about upcoming changes – new sites, new workflows, etc
    • Support clinicians with resolution of technical issues while on-shift
  • Facilitate the management of neurologists and Advanced Practice Providers (APPs)
    • Communicate company and service line policies
    • Ensure timely completion of signed orders, consult notes, and other clinical documentation
    • Track progress of CLP and first-shift readiness, partner productively with CL&P to ensure appropriate prioritization, communicate to Scheduling
    • Anticipate expiration of CLP, EMR access, DEA/CDS, and other necessary elements for clinical work, proactively engage clinicians and CLP to avoid downtime
    • Maintain up-to-date information on clinicians’ profiles: work status, contract type, Pod assignment, demographics, etc.
    • Maintain comprehensiveness and accuracy of administrative datasets
  • Facilitate the administration of Pods or other clinical teams
    • Organize Pod meetings, keep minutes, track progress of action items, prepare materials
    • Support Pod Directors in planning go-lives of new sites and new services
    • Provide performance metrics to Pod Directors, co-develop plans for individual clinicians, ensure execution of management tasks
    • Create and provide client calendars as needed
  • Other duties as assigned
